Understanding Control Arms
Control arms are crucial components of a vehicle’s suspension system. They serve as a link between the wheels and the chassis, allowing for vertical movement while maintaining proper wheel alignment. Typically, control arms come in two varieties upper and lower. The upper control arm (UCA) is responsible for maintaining the position of the wheel during suspension travel, especially in MacPherson strut setups commonly found in many modern vehicles.
What Are Forged Upper Control Arms?
Forged upper control arms are made using a forging process, where metal is shaped by applying immense pressure to a solid piece of material. This process alters the internal structure of the metal, resulting in improved molecular density and strength. This stands in contrast to the casting process, where metal is poured into a mold and allowed to cool, potentially leading to weaknesses or imperfections within the material.
The forging process allows manufacturers to produce control arms that are not only stronger than their cast counterparts but also lighter. This reduction in weight contributes to improved handling and performance by lowering the overall unsprung weight of the vehicle.
Benefits of Forged Upper Control Arms
1. Strength and Durability One of the most significant benefits of forged upper control arms is their strength. The forging process creates a product that can withstand the rigors of off-road driving, aggressive cornering, and heavy loads without bending or breaking. For those who push their vehicles to the limits, the choice of forged control arms is clear.
2. Weight Savings Performance vehicles thrive on weight reduction. Because forged upper control arms are constructed from high-strength alloys, manufacturers can create a part that is lighter than traditional cast components without sacrificing durability. Reduced weight means better acceleration, braking, and overall handling.
3. Improved Suspension Geometry Upgraded forged upper control arms can also enhance suspension geometry. Many aftermarket options allow for adjustability, enabling drivers to fine-tune their suspension settings. This can lead to improved camber and caster angles, resulting in better tire contact with the road, enhanced grip, and improved cornering performance.
4. Increased Wheel Travel Some forged upper control arms are designed to allow for increased wheel travel. This is particularly beneficial for off-road vehicles or those that participate in motorsports, as it provides better shock absorption and a smoother ride over rough terrain.
5. Customization Options When considering performance upgrades, many car enthusiasts look for parts that allow for customization. Forged upper control arms are available in various designs and configurations, allowing users to select options that best meet their specific driving needs or style.
